Reduce 6/15
Here we will reduce the fraction 6/15 to its lowest form. That means that we will reduce 6/15 as much as we can while keeping its value intact.
In other words, we we will reduce 6/15 to its equivalent lowest form.
To do this, we first find the greatest common divisor of 6 and 15 which is 3.
Then, we divide both 6 and 15 by their greatest common divisor like so:
6/3 = 2
15/3 = 5
Therefore, 6/15 reduced as much as possible is:
2/5
NOTE: If the result was an improper fraction, then we also reduced it further by converting it to a mixed or whole number.
